CanvasKit - Skia + WebAssembly
==============================

Skia now offers a WebAssembly build for easy deployment of our graphics APIs on
the web.

CanvasKit provides a playground for testing new Canvas and SVG platform APIs,
enabling fast-paced development on the web platform.
It can also be used as a deployment mechanism for custom web apps requiring
cutting-edge features, like Skia's [Lottie
animation](https://skia.org/user/modules/skottie) support.


Features
--------

  - WebGL context encapsulated as an SkSurface, allowing for direct drawing to
    an HTML canvas
  - Core set of Skia canvas/paint/path/text APIs available, see bindings
  - Draws to a hardware-accelerated backend
  - Security tested with Skia's fuzzers
